Dutchess prisons among the state's highest in overtime use
By poughkeepsiejournal.com- Amanda J Purcell
Published: 08/18/2015

Prisons in Dutchess County spent more than $11 million in overtime in the first five months of the year, with each of the three prisons ranking among the leaders in the state in overtime hours.

Through June 11, Green Haven Correctional Facility in Stormville had $3,931,572 in overtime, according to state-produced data obtained by the Poughkeepsie Journal under the Freedom of Information Law. Fishkill Correctional Facility in Beacon had $3,728,025 in overtime and Downstate Correctional Facility in the Town of Fishkill had $3,702,960. Between the three facilities, more than 360 employees each made more than $10,000 in overtime in the first 23 weeks of 2015.

New York's prison overtime bill reached $74,579,255 through June 11. The total put the state on pace to spend less than the $180 million in 2014. That trend was before a 23-day manhunt for two escapees from Clinton Correctional Facility cost an additional $59 million in overtime to the prison system and State Police in June and July, according to data obtained by various media outlets through a Freedom of Information request.
